Original abstract
Calibration of the multicomponent sensor represents a complex problem with highly interesting mathematical solution. As the complexity of calibration model must reflect all important sensor features, some of the calculations during calibration seem to be utmost difficult. Therefore two-steps approach for specific representative of the multicomponent sensors – tactile matrix sensor – was adopted, enabling simplification of several model elements.
